Salesforce Governance, Security, and User Adoption

A successful go-live is the start of a new operational reality, not the finish line. The organizations that get lasting value build governance, security, and adoption in from the beginning.

Governance Framework

naming conventions; sandbox strategy for dev/UAT/training; release management with version control; DevOps and CI/CD setup; change request workflow; and documentation standards your internal team can maintain.

Security and Compliance Architecture

role hierarchy, profiles, permission sets, sharing rules, field-level and record-level security designed from first principles; audit trails, data retention, and alignment with GDPR, HIPAA, SOC 2, and Australian Privacy Act where required.

Adoption and Change Management

adoption baseline, role-based low-friction UX, targeted training, power-user champions, and a communication plan; adoption KPIs measured and reported throughout.

Platform Performance and Scalability Planning

governor-limit exposure, SOQL efficiency, API optimization, and integration performance designed for current load and projected growth. Scalability is a design-time decision, not expensive remediation later.

What does a good Salesforce governance plan include?

Standards, environments/sandbox strategy, release & DevOps, security & sharing, data quality & retention, and roles & responsibilities with clear owners.

Can you help us migrate from legacy CRMs and spreadsheets?

Yes. Assess, map, cleanse, pilot and cutover. We preserve metadata, automate validation, and ensure data integrity with testable checkpoints.

How much do Salesforce consultants charge per hour?

Salesforce consultants typically charge between $75 to $200 per hour, depending on their experience, certifications, and project scope. But offshoring Salesforce to countries like India can significantly lower the cost, often ranging from $25 to $60 per hour, without compromising on quality.
